Which Features Should You Look for in the Best Leather Soccer Cleats?

The quality of leather significantly impacts the cleat’s longevity and performance. Premium leather, such as kangaroo leather, is often more flexible and provides a better touch on the ball compared to synthetic materials, making it a top choice for serious players.

Traction and stud configuration are vital for maintaining grip on the field. Different stud patterns are designed for various surfaces; for example, conical studs provide better rotational movement, while bladed studs offer enhanced acceleration and braking capabilities.

Cushioning and support are essential for comfort and injury prevention. Features like padded insoles and cushioned midsoles help absorb impact, while proper arch support can enhance stability and reduce fatigue during intense matches.

The weight of the cleat can greatly influence a player’s speed and agility. Lighter cleats are often preferred for fast-paced play, allowing players to make quick movements without feeling weighed down.

How Can You Extend the Lifespan of Your Leather Soccer Cleats?

To extend the lifespan of your leather soccer cleats, consider the following methods:

  • Regular Cleaning: Keeping your cleats clean is essential to maintain the leather’s integrity. Use a damp cloth to remove dirt and mud after each use, and occasionally apply a leather cleaner designed for sports gear to prevent buildup.
  • Conditioning the Leather: Conditioning helps to keep the leather supple and prevents it from drying out and cracking. Apply a quality leather conditioner every few weeks, especially if your cleats are frequently exposed to moisture and varying temperatures.
  • Proper Storage: Store your cleats in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ight when not in use. Avoid keeping them in damp areas or in their original box, as this can trap moisture and lead to mold or mildew.
  • Using Shoe Trees: Inserting shoe trees after each use can help maintain the shape of your cleats and absorb moisture. This prevents creasing and extends the overall life of the leather.
  • Avoiding Water Exposure: While some leather soccer cleats are treated for water resistance, excessive exposure to water can damage the leather. If they get wet, dry them at room temperature and avoid direct heat sources like radiators or hairdryers.
  • Rotating Cleats: If you play frequently, consider having multiple pairs of cleats to rotate. This allows each pair to rest and recover from wear, which can significantly extend their lifespan.
  • Re-soling and Repairs: Address any issues like worn-out soles or damaged stitching promptly. Taking your cleats to a professional cobbler for repairs can save you the cost of buying new ones and keep your cleats in top condition.
